Firstly, you have to have the AI control app, which can be activated via the UI Editor on the menu bar while in-game. After the app is placed on your screen, switch to the vehicle you'd wish to have AI. Make sure the AI is on the main track (the only place with working AI) and set the AI to either chase, flee or random (I recommend random if you plan on racing the AI.) Also, you can now set the speed of the AI to make it go faster around the track and make it more challenging. I hope I explained this well enough, and you if you're still confused send me a PM.
